A day in the life of a Senior Lettings Negotiator at haart Estate Agents in Walthamstow:

  • Liaising with prospective tenants and arranging property viewings in line with their needs
  • Negotiating offers and agreeing new tenancies
  • Marketing properties to tenants utilizing various marketing skills
  • Developing and maintaining strong relationships with Landlords and Tenants
  • Assisting the teams to successfully achieve KPI’s
  • Providing support to your colleagues in your manager's absence
  • A focus on generating new and repeat business
  • Canvassing the local area
  • Ensuring properties adhere to health and safety standards
  • Ensuring your colleagues and the business are risk-averse and following the highest compliance standards for all regulatory bodies.

How to prepare for a job interview at Spicerhaart

Know Your Market

Before the interview, do your homework on the Walthamstow property market. Understand current trends, average rental prices, and what makes properties in the area appealing to tenants. This knowledge will show your enthusiasm and readiness to contribute.

Showcase Your People Skills

As a Lettings Negotiator, building relationships is key. Prepare examples of how you've successfully interacted with clients or resolved conflicts in the past. Highlight your ability to work well in a team and create a positive environment.

Demonstrate Your Initiative

Be ready to discuss times when you took the lead on a project or initiative. Whether it was generating new business or improving processes, showing that you can work independently and drive results will impress the interviewers.

Prepare Questions

Interviews are a two-way street. Prepare thoughtful questions about the company culture, team dynamics, and growth opportunities within haart Estate Agents. This not only shows your interest but also helps you assess if it's the right fit for you.
